We are currently seeking a Bill of Material Analyst for our Sidney, OH location. This role is crucial in creating and maintaining accurate multi-level Bills of Material (BOM) and Item Master records for Finished Goods, which support order management, manufacturing, material requirements, and cost management. The analyst will also be responsible for managing nameplate and product information for customer databases, ensuring compliance with customer requirements and operating system standards. As a Bill of Material Analyst, you will coordinate information from various cross-functional areas, including Engineering, Design, Change Control, Regulatory Agencies, and Product Planning. You will construct BOMs and nameplate information based on inputs from these areas and will need to understand operating systems like Oracle to apply Engineering Change Notices (ECNs) effectively. Your role will involve active engagement in cross-functional communication to ensure the accuracy and timely maintenance of BOMs and product information. You will evaluate all requests to update BOMs and nameplates, ensuring compliance with customer requirements and product planning goals. Additionally, you will participate in all BOM-related support for Design and Engineering, making this a dynamic and impactful position within our organization.
